Synthesis
1.045 g of (S)-4-ethyl-4-hydroxy-1H-pyrano[3',4':6,7]indolizino[1,2-b]quinoline-3,14(4H,12H)-dione (CPT lactone) was accurately weighed in a sterile round bottom flask (250 mL). Water equivalent to 20% of the final volume was added to give a final concentration of CPT of 25 mM.Subsequently, 3.34 g of 1N NaOH solution was added to the inhomogeneous mixture, ensuring that the molar ratio of CPT to NaOH was 1:1.05.The mixture was stirred vigorously at 50°C until complete dissolution, a process that took about 1 h, indicating that the CPT lactone had been quantitatively converted to its water-soluble carboxylate form. It was shown that raising the temperature to 90°C further accelerated this conversion process. Although stirring for 4-6 hours has no significant effect on the chemical stability of CPT, it is recommended that this stirring time be maintained to ensure a complete reaction. Upon completion of the reaction, the solution is cooled to room temperature and can be stored under light conditions at 4°C for at least 24 hours. (Long-term storage stability of CPT-Na stock solutions will be discussed subsequently.) The pH of the final solution should be maintained between 10 and 11.5.
